e are looking for a Scrub Theatre Nurse with Synergy Medical, you will play a vital role in supporting surgical teams and ensuring the smooth running of operations.
Key ResponsibilitiesPrepare and set up the operating room before procedures.
Ensure all surgical instruments and equipment are sterile and ready for use.
Safely and efficiently pass instruments and equipment to the surgeon during surgery.
Assist with draping patients and de-gowning post-procedure.
Respond promptly and calmly in surgical emergencies, following instructions and protocols.
Complete accurate surgical documentation.
Support patient transfer and handover to the recovery room.
Carry out additional duties as directed by the surgical team.
(Responsibilities may vary depending on location, speciality, and level of experience.)
